Leadership plays a pivotal role in strategic direction, with the management team boasting an average tenure of 2.9 years. This experience facilitates effective decision-making and strategic planning, crucial for navigating market complexities. The company's strong financial position is underscored by having more cash than total debt, ensuring stability and flexibility in operations. Additionally, WFG's commitment to shareholder value is evident in its consistent dividend increases over the past decade. The company is trading at CA$128.35, significantly below its estimated fair value of CA$418.13, suggesting it may be undervalued, offering potential for price appreciation and highlighting its market positioning.

Over the past five years, losses have increased at a rate of 4.5% annually, indicating persistent profitability issues. Moreover, WFG's revenue growth forecast of 4.8% per year lags behind the Canadian market's 7%, potentially impacting its competitive edge. The dividend yield of 1.39% is also low compared to the top 25% of Canadian dividend payers, reflecting volatility and unreliability in dividend payments over the past decade. These factors may deter potential investors and highlight areas needing strategic focus.
